Where you are is who you are. The further inside you the place moves, the more your identity is intertwined with it. Never casual, the choice of place is the choice of something you crave.

📖 Frances Mayes

The essence of a person's identity is deeply connected to their surrounding environment, according to Frances Mayes in "Under the Tuscan Sun." As individuals attach themselves to a particular place, their sense of self becomes more integrated with that location. This suggests that where one chooses to live or spend time is not merely a practical decision but reflects deeper yearnings and desires.

Mayes emphasizes that the choice of place is significant and meaningful, indicating that it resonates with personal cravings and aspirations. The idea implies that our surroundings shape who we are, and as we become more immersed in them, our identities evolve, highlighting the profound relationship between self and space.
